		<description><![CDATA[There are some No Exam policies that will accept application for life insurance at any stage of pregnancy, and at reasonable price. If applying for a policy with medical underwriting, most companies will postpone until after the baby is born if in the third trimester. Up until then, the best rate class is possible.]]></description>
